    As with the others that have posted here, I find this topic to be very interesting. I have not had any experiences with "ghosts" per se but I have had many experiences with "shadow beings" and other paranormal anomalies.

    The one that sticks in my head the most has to be the experience I had in an apartment that I lived in with my best friend and his wife. We were setting in the living room one night and watching TV when all three of use saw a dark shadow move through the kitchen and in to the pantry. We thought at first that it may be a shadow from someone outside but there are only two windows that had any access to the kitchen. Both of them had the blinds and curtains closed because it was night time and we don't like people being able to see in to the house. It was a very distinct male figure and no sounds were made and nothing was found to indicate that someone else was in the house. To this day, even while typing this article, I get goose bumps when thinking about it.

    This same apartment has been the subject of many other sightings, like strange flashes of light from many of the rooms and strange noises that couldn't be explained. I have even had many experiences with energy vortexes there. Many times during the day and at night I had experienced a pulling sensation that felt like the feeling you get when you take a vacuum and stick it close to your skin. It felt exactly like every part of my body was being pulled towards the center of the room I was in. This always happened in my bedroom either while I was playing on my computer or while I was laying in bed at night sleeping. It was such a strong sensation that it would wake me up.

    The only other notable experiences I have had have been ones that my friends have experienced while I was around. Everyone that knows me will tell you that I have something following me around as they have seen it. It appears as a male "shadow person" that usually paces or stands around behind me. I am not sure why it follows me or what it is but it appears even in places that have never had any paranormal experiences or around people that have never had paranormal experiences before. Each time it appears I get a chill down my spine and a slight case of the goose bumps. I've never had any problems with it and it has never harmed anyone or anything around me. Even my dog has had odd experiences with it and will jump up and run behind me barking at what appears to be nothing at all.

    I've always been a believer but, just like my faith in the "creator", I am still skeptical about what these experiences may be and until undeniable proof can be given I will continue to keep an open and analytical mind.

    As for ghost hunters, I have watched all episodes of their first two seasons and at first I was intrigued by the show but after careful consideration and analysis of the show it appears to me that they are legitimate paranormal investigators but the show itself is just that, a show. Sure, they try their best to keep it all real and scientific but discovery channel has done their normal thing and the show has WAY too many inconsistencies in it that are there for show. Many times they found "proof" that a place is haunted but, even without being a professional paranormal investigator, I could easily disprove that the evidence they found was misinterpreted or faked. Either way, the show does make for some good entertainment and has its educational value as well.
